Jacobs, Victoria R.; Kusiak, Julie – Teaching Children Mathematics, 2006
This article describes the results of a year-long exploration of first graders' tool use. It also showcases instructional activities designed to link tool use with quantitative understanding. (Contains 3 figures.)

Crouse, Richard; Bassett, Denise – Mathematics Teacher, 1975
Brief mystery stories such as the three presented here can be used to help students develop critical reading and thinking skills, as well as to introduce the notion of indirect proof. (SD)

Kaye, R. M. – Mathematics Teaching, 1975
Students were given the problem: Given a deck of cards in a certain order, after how many shuffles will it return to its original order? They worked with small decks of cards to develop a general formula, but were unhappy with the results. (SD)
